Ran a little test last night, started up the truck and turned on the lights then just waited, after about ten mins it seemed like something heated and the random flckering on and off started, all exterior lights and instrument panel, even the dome light which I had turned on with the HL switch... Today I went a little nuts at the auto parts store, so I now have new LED lights in every exterior bulb possible, the Grote LED HL seem really nice BTW, I hope anyway. It took the amperage draw on that circuit down from around 14A to 5A when all lights are on. I also changed the headlight switch and the dimmer switch at the same time I put in all the LED. Well, I started her up and went for a night drive, no better way to test than in the field...
One hour and not a single flicker on/off. Crossing my fingers I wiped this one out.
